Gucci is an influential Italian luxury fashion house renowned for its eclectic, contemporary and romantic aesthetic and for meticulous Italian craftsmanship. The brand is part of the Kering Group, a global leader in luxury apparel and accessories, and is recognised for redefining 21st‑century luxury through innovative design and premium client experiences.

The luxury industry is characterised by a diverse and nuanced nomenclature. Esteemed houses frequently employ proprietary terminology, and even within a single organisation like Gucci, titles may vary across global markets to reflect local conventions. To ensure absolute clarity, Cerulean assigns a standardised, industry-coherent canonical title to every listing. However, it is worth noting that this role is functionally synonymous with «Sales Advisor», «Luxury Sales Consultant», «Retail Sales Associate», «Client Relations Advisor», and other variations.
